Climbing 'Kaca' (6+) on Anica Kuk in Paklenica is a classic experience and a significant challenge. Anica Kuk, the jewel of Paklenica National Park, is renowned for its towering limestone walls and demanding routes. 'Kaca' (also sometimes spelled 'Katsa') is a popular line due to its moderate difficulty (for Anica Kuk standards!) and its enjoyable, varied climbing. Expect sustained, well-protected pitches with features like pockets, crimps, and laybacks. Good footwork and a solid understanding of crack climbing techniques will be invaluable. The exposure is breathtaking, and the views from the top are simply stunning. While rated 6+, 'Kaca' demands respect and should not be underestimated. Be prepared for physical and mental endurance, and make sure you're comfortable leading at that grade or have a reliable and experienced partner. Overall, 'Kaca' offers a rewarding and unforgettable climbing adventure in one of Europe's most iconic crags.
